A flexible, high-performance XML parser for Node.js with pluggable output builders, a composable value parser chain, and multiple input modes.
- Multiple input modes — string, Buffer, Uint8Array, Node.js streams, and incremental feed/end API. More can be created easily.
- Pluggable output builders — swap
CompactObjBuilderforNodeTreeBuilder,OrderedKeyValueBuilder, or your own subclass ofBaseOutputBuilder - Composable value parser chain — built-in parsers for entities, numbers, booleans, trim, and currency; custom parsers receive full context
- Path-expression stop nodes — capture raw content inside matched tags (e.g.
<script>,<style>) without further XML parsing; configurable enclosure skipping for nested quotes and comments - Entity expansion control — built-in XML entities, optional HTML entities, external/registered entities, DocType-declared entities; all with DoS-prevention limits
- Auto-close for lenient HTML parsing — configurable recovery from unclosed tags and mismatched close tags; collect parse errors without throwing
- DoS protection — configurable limits on nesting depth, attributes per tag, entity count, entity size, and total expansion length
- Security — prototype-pollution prevention; reserved names throw; dangerous names are sanitised by default
- TypeScript definitions — complete dual-mode types (
fxp.d.tsfor ESM,fxp.d.ctsfor CJS) - ES Modules + CommonJS —
"type": "module"source with a bundled CJS output

Stop nodes capture raw content without further XML parsing — useful for <script>, <style>, or embedded HTML fragments.
import { xmlEnclosures, quoteEnclosures } from 'flexible-xml-parser';
new XMLParser({
tags: {
stopNodes: [
'..script', // plain — first </script> ends collection
{ expression: 'body..pre', skipEnclosures: [...xmlEnclosures] },
{ expression: 'head..style', skipEnclosures: [...xmlEnclosures, ...quoteEnclosures] },
],
},
onStopNode(tagDetail, rawContent, matcher) {
console.log(tagDetail.name, rawContent);
},
});xmlEnclosures covers XML comments and CDATA; quoteEnclosures covers single-quote, double-quote, and template literals.
